The first Burlesque Shows were introduced in the 17th century as jokes or mocking performances that were ultimately transformed by well-known culture like opera or Shakespeare and parodied it. They would often use the original music or popular music of the time and re-write the lyrics for comic effect. Venues became known for showing burlesque during this era.
Burlesque gradually transformed into striptease with more and more elaborate costumes. The most notable first sighting was Little Egypt introduced the ‘hootchie-kooch’ at the 1893 Chicago World’s Fair. The continued moral outrage towards burlesque dancing further increased its attraction.
